We have reached the Fourth Sunday after Pentecost (28 June 2020) and we continue with principal readings from the Book of Genesis.
Today’s story is about how Abraham almost sacrificed his son, Isaac.
Rev. Geoff McKee offers some thoughts which are close to the relational core of this well-known tale and reflects on what it reveals about Abraham and the implications for future people of faith.
